<p class="wp-block-paragraph">Matt Canada, offensive coordinator for the Pittsburgh Steelers has been fired.  Why is this significant and important?  Well this hasn&#8217;t been done in the Steelers organization since 1941.  But they were losing the locker room, players were talking bad about their OC.  A few weeks ago Ken Dorsey offensive coordinator for the Buffalo Bills was fired.  These teams are holding their coaches accountable, and doing what needs to be done.  Well, Josh Harris and Commanders team, now is the time.</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">You have lost twice to arguably the worse team in the league in the New York Giants.  Your defense who has talent, are not playing as a unit and lacking communication on the field.  They are underachieving, and it starts with Jack Del Rio.  Why he still has a job makes no sense?  Ron Rivera has checked out, as he sees the writing on the wall.  If you look at his body of work, it has been mediocrity for four years.  As a defensive minded coach, your defense is horrible and can&#8217;t even stop the worse team and a 3rd string QB.  These types of results are not acceptable and something needs to be done.  I understand why you don&#8217;t fire Rivera today or tomorrow before the Thanksgiving game, but if you get blown out by the Cowboys, it&#8217;s time to clean house.</p>

<p class="wp-block-paragraph">Attention all Washington Commanders Fans!  You can now breathe.  After 24 years of misery at the owner position a new era has begun.  There&#8217;s a new ownership team comprised of big name people who just want to win, and bring back what Washington used to be.  </p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">Daniel Snyder came on in 1999 with the intentions of building a winning football team, but that was far from what happened.  He ran Washington like a business focused on expensive parking, food and other amenities.  He made baffling decisions where as a fan you just scratch your head.  All of these headaches will hopefully go away and judging off the recent press conference of new owners, that will happen.  </p>

<p class="wp-block-paragraph">There has already been proof with ticket sales off the roof.  It sounds like they are not focused on the name as much as the team and the fan experience.  Magic Johnson, Josh Harris, and Mitchell Rales want to bring that experience back to Washington.  This includes making the stadium a welcoming place to come to.  Not a stadium with overpriced parking, food, old seats and other aging infrastructure.  But the biggest thing they will bring is the eagerness to win, and bringing Washington back to where it was in the 80&#8217;s and 90&#8217;s.  </p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">Washington has a young and talented team that is already building for the future.  This new ownership solidifies that Washington will be a contender within the next few years.  Washington Fans, the weight is off your shoulders, now we can focus on watching a solid football team from top to bottom.  </p>
